Transaction 56f862128b80b8e30e68144e4a74fdd67af53412419587db2e604d02a31eb879
1 Input
2 Outputs
- 56f862128b80b8e30e68144e4a74fdd67af53412419587db2e604d02a31eb879:0
- 56f862128b80b8e30e68144e4a74fdd67af53412419587db2e604d02a31eb879:1
value 1373036
address 12SMUmcCDjsAh752Agt7VayAVgiiqwLR3P
value 6531616964
address 175EHQinadYueQT4yuJY3ymTJFY9gXq6V6